Help! App is too complicated for many of my clients, can I simplify it for them? by Interesting-Edge-221 in FitPros

[–]SammyFitPros 0 points1 point  (0 children)

<image>

A lot of your issues can be solved through the Customize App Features on the https://dashboard.fitpros.io/dashboard/mobile-app/custom-branding page.

They get confused with the fact that they see both a page for workouts and a page titled "programs" - and for the program to show on their main inital screen they have to save that program even though I already assigned it to them. Is there a way to simplify this so that I assign a program and they see it right away after opening without having to do any additional things?

You can do this for clients if you like.

  1. Log into the mobile app with your coaching details
  2. Click "View As"
  3. Save the program/s you'd like them to see

They forget what week/day they are on. QuickCoach would directly just show them their next program. While in this case they have to open the program and go to the correct week/workout day. Is there a way to simplify this so they are just directed to their next workout every time they open the app?

Toggle the "Auto-Navigate to Incomplete Week"

When logging their workouts/exercises, there are too many variables for them to look at and click on (the calculator, for example, has been confusing sometimes). There is also no check box to be ticked off for each exercise... I know it appears automatically after they input their reps under each set.. but I've had people tell me they found it confusing. Is there a way to change this?

Toggle the settings off that'd you'd like to hide

Finally, they get confused by the fact that they can edit things. Basically, there is too much freedom on the user end. It would technically be as simple as "just don't tap anything you don't need" but they can't seem to help themselves and then I have to spend ages explaining things to them over and over again. Is there a way to limit user freedom so all they can do is log in, go to their next workout and habit, tick it off, and that's it?

Toggle the settings off that'd you'd like to hide

  1. Checking if a client has finished all workouts

You’re not missing anything, that view isn’t in the app yet. Right now most coaches keep up to date through the dashboard notifications. It's not an optimal solution, research and time will be invested into a better solution at some stage.

  1. About exercise history in the free plan

The Pro features are picked with a lot of care, partly for user experience, but honestly even more for keeping the project sustainable. FitPros is free because the core features are lightweight enough to offer at scale.

Full exercise history, across multiple clients and multiple exercises, is one of the heaviest server operations in the entire app. If every free user had unlimited access to that load, the app would literally become too expensive to run, it would tank the project in days.

So it’s not about paywalling “basic” stuff; it’s about making sure the app can stay free, fast, and available for everyone long-term.
